Discover the Best Coffee Shops in Miami with Coffee Pairing Menus

Miami is a city known for its vibrant culture, beautiful beaches, and world-class food scene. But did you know it’s also a great destination for coffee lovers? Whether you’re a casual coffee drinker or a true connoisseur, Miami offers many coffee shops that take your coffee experience to the next level. One exciting trend in the city’s coffee culture is coffee pairing menus, where coffee is matched with food or treats to create unforgettable flavor combinations. In this blog, we’ll explore the best coffee shops in Miami where you can enjoy expertly crafted coffee pairing menus.


1. Panther Coffee

Location: Multiple locations across Miami

A true icon in Miami’s coffee scene, Panther Coffee is known for its high-quality, artisanal coffee. Their small-batch roasted beans create a bold coffee experience that pairs beautifully with delicious bites. While Panther Coffee doesn’t always have a formal pairing menu, the staff often recommends pairing their smooth cold brew or cortado with croissants and pastries from local bakers. Their biscotti or almond cake is particularly popular among regulars who love the way the nutty flavors complement the coffee’s rich notes.


2. Vice City Bean

Location: 1657 N Miami Ave

Vice City Bean is all about creating a community atmosphere with coffee that stands out. Their shop regularly sources fresh pastries, sandwiches, and baked goods to match their premium coffee offerings. One of their standout pairings is their pour-over coffee paired with a slice of banana bread. The sweetness of the bread works perfectly with the bright and balanced flavors in the coffee. If you’re feeling adventurous, try a matcha latte paired with their almond cookies for a unique twist.


3. ALL DAY

Location: 1035 N Miami Ave

If you’re serious about coffee, ALL DAY should be at the top of your list. This modern and stylish coffee shop offers one of the best coffee pairing menus in Miami, focusing on high-quality ingredients and creative combinations. Their espresso pairs beautifully with a range of sweet or savory snacks, from lavender-infused cookies to house-cured salmon toast. For a truly special experience, try their signature Nitro Cold Brew with a slice of their lemon olive oil cake—the citrus notes blend seamlessly with the smooth cold brew for a refreshing treat.


4. Suite Habana Cafe

Location: 2609 N Miami Ave

A cozy Cuban-inspired coffee shop, Suite Habana Cafe combines Miami’s love for coffee with Latin American flavors. Their menu is known for pairing strong Cuban coffee (like a colada or cafecito) with traditional bites such as pastelitos (flaky pastries filled with guava or meat) or croquetas. The combination of rich coffee with savory croquetas is a crowd-pleaser, while the sweetness of guava-filled pastelitos balances perfectly with bold espresso. It’s a true taste of Miami’s local culture in every bite and sip.


5. Sabal Coffee

Location: 3372 Coral Way

Tucked away in Coral Gables, Sabal Coffee is minimalistic yet full of flavor. Coffee pairing here is an art form, with their menu often evolving based on seasonal ingredients. A favorite pairing is their expertly brewed cappuccino paired with a slice of chocolate tart or their salted caramel cookie. The creamy, frothy coffee and decadent desserts create a harmony of flavors that feels comforting and indulgent. If you visit during fall or winter, their seasonal pairings with pumpkin bread or spiced apple tarts are worth trying.


6. Puroast Coffee

Location: 6876 Collins Ave

Puroast Coffee stands out for its low-acid coffee, which is a great option for people with sensitive stomachs or those who want a smoother coffee experience. This shop curates pairing suggestions for their various roasts, offering thoughtful combinations with baked goods like oatmeal raisin cookies, cinnamon rolls, or fruit tarts. Their caramel-flavored cold brew is a must-try, particularly when paired with a slice of cheesecake—it’s dessert and coffee in one blissful package.


7. Eternity Coffee Roasters

Location: 117 SE 2nd Ave

Eternity Coffee Roasters is dedicated to single-origin, meticulously crafted coffee. The shop puts a strong emphasis on flavor profiles, making it a fantastic spot for coffee pairings. Their knowledgeable baristas can suggest pairings based on your coffee choice. For example, bright, citrusy coffees pair well with a berry tart, while darker roasts complement chocolate chip cookies. Eternity’s espresso affogato—a shot of espresso poured over creamy vanilla gelato—is another must-try pairing that combines coffee and dessert in one perfect dish.


8. Bebito’s

Location: 1504 Bay Rd

Bebito’s is a cafe where Miami’s Latin roots and modern vibes converge. Their specialty coffee pairs wonderfully with addictively good Cuban-inspired bites, like guava waffles or dulce de leche cookies. One of their standout pairings is a cafecito with Cuban bread topped with guava and cream cheese. Bebito’s is perfect for those who love bold flavors and want to explore pairings that highlight Miami’s cultural heritage.
